General description

KLH-conjugated linear peptide corresponding to human phospho-Raptor (Ser696).

Quality

Evaluated by Western Blotting in PMA treated HeLa cell lysate.

Western Blotting Analysis: A 1:250 dilution of this antibody detected phospho-Raptor (Ser696) in 10 µg of PMA treated HeLa cell lysate.

Physical properties

~150 kDa observed

Physical form

Purified rabbit polyclonal in buffer containing 0.1 M Tris-Glycine (pH 7.4), 150 mM NaCl with 0.05% sodium azide.

Storage and Stability

Stable for 1 year at 2-8°C from date of receipt.

Other Notes

Human. Predicted to react with Chimpanzee, Bat, Monkey based on 100% sequence homology.
